1 open the resivoir top and place a rag around the opening.
2 assure that there are no kinks in the brake hose.
3 apply pressure to the piston. 3 years ago when I put Redbox pads on I had a slight ridge on the piston. I had to use a C clamp DO NOT apply high clamping force!!! and keep rotating the piston. I had to as the piston retracted keep a slight force against the piston. If you have added fluid to the brake system watch the possible overflow. The fluid makes sort of a mess.
